
JS
文章平均质量分 80
幸运的lucia
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Js的位运算符
(1)交换变量(个人感觉,不实用,建议使用es6的结构方法,更简单)计算公式:a << n = a * (2 ^ n)计算公式:a >> n = a / (2 ^ n)转为二进制数据,向右移动n位,符号位也会跟着移动。计算公式(取反,减1):~a = -a - 1。均转为二进制数据,同1取1,其他取0。均转为二进制数据,同0取0,其他取1。均转为二进制数据,不同为1,同为0。转为二进制数据,0取1,1取0。转为二进制数据,向左移动n位。转为二进制数据,向右移动n位。如:2 & 2 ,结果是2。原创 2023-09-20 10:27:48 · 186 阅读 · 0 评论 -
Js的Blob/File/ArrayBuffer/FileReader的详解
学习Blob、File、ArrayBuffer、FileReader原创 2023-05-18 17:52:49 · 859 阅读 · 0 评论 -
前端面试经历3-5年
面试建议原创 2023-02-14 17:51:12 · 760 阅读 · 0 评论 -
XMLHttpRequest基础知识
XMLHttpRequest 是一个由浏览器的js环境提供的一个API对象,主要用来浏览器与服务器交换数据,简称XHR。XHR可以在页面加载完后,再继续向服务端发送请求及接收返回的数据时,达到不刷新页面情况下更新页面数据。XHR使用的协议不同于HTTP,不仅可以使用XML格式的数据,也支持JSON、HTML、或者纯文本。原创 2022-12-05 20:33:56 · 1538 阅读 · 0 评论 -
vue鼠标移入移出事件注意事项
vue鼠标移入移出事件注意事项发生冒泡事件今天在写一个鼠标的移入移出的事件,使用mouseout和mouseover期间,踩了一个大坑,经过半天的排查,终于发现是发生了冒泡事件。把mouseout和mouseover绑在父元素上,移过父元素和子元素都会触发。即子元素mouseover和mouseout事件会冒泡至父元素一、解决方法使用 mouseenter 和 mouseleave 事件。这两个事件是根据组件在页面上的范围进行计算的,只要在某个组件上添加了这两个事件,会计算鼠标的位置,只要在组件原创 2021-06-07 22:35:52 · 20197 阅读 · 3 评论